A simple modification of deadlock prevention policy of S3PR based on elementary siphons

被引:7
|
作者
Chao, Daniel Yuh [1 ]
机构
[1] Natl Chengchi Univ, Dept Management & Informat Sci, Taipei 11623, Taiwan
关键词
deadlock control; flexible manufacturing systems; Petri nets; siphons; FLEXIBLE MANUFACTURING SYSTEMS; LIVENESS-ENFORCING SUPERVISORS; PETRI NETS; INCREMENTAL APPROACH; DEPENDENT SIPHONS;
D O I
10.1177/0142331208095674
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
We propose to extend our proprietary approach of siphon synthesis to a new simple deadlock control policy. To prevent each strict minimal siphon (SMS) S from becoming empty of tokens, we often add a control place V-S and associated arcs to form an invariant to control the number of tokens leaking from S. In a disturbanceless approach, the control (called Type-1) arcs are chosen to disturb the original uncontrolled model as little as possible, to reach as many states as possible. However, this policy may generate new SMSs and hence require adding too many control places and arcs to the original Petri net model. Thus, Ezpeleta et al. moved all output (called Type-2) arcs of each V-S to the output transition of the entry (called idle place) of input raw materials to limit their rate into the system, called all-sided, or SMSless approach. This may overly constrain the system so that many reachable states are no longer attainable. We hence propose an intermediate, called the one-sided, approach, which does not generate new SMS, based on our siphon-synthesis theory, by appropriately choosing the locations of Type-1 arcs and it can reach more states than the all-sided approach. The same results can be extended to the elementary-siphon approach by Li et al. except with no need to fine-tune the locations of Type-1 arcs. Comparison with other approaches has been made.
引用
收藏
页码:93 / 115
页数:23
相关论文
共 50 条
  • [1] Conservative control policy for weakly dependent siphons in S3PR based on elementary siphons
    Chao, D. Y.
    [J]. IET CONTROL THEORY AND APPLICATIONS, 2010, 4 (07): : 1298 - 1302
  • [2] IMPROVED CONTROLLABILITY TEST FOR DEPENDENT SIPHONS IN S3PR BASED ON ELEMENTARY SIPHONS
    Chao, Daniel Y.
    [J]. ASIAN JOURNAL OF CONTROL, 2010, 12 (03) : 377 - 391
  • [3] Deadlock Prevention Policy for S3PR - Application to Robot Planning
    Wang, Xu
    Mahulea, Cristian
    Silva, Manuel
    [J]. 2014 IEEE EMERGING TECHNOLOGY AND FACTORY AUTOMATION (ETFA), 2014,
  • [4] Design of a Petri Net Based Deadlock Prevention Policy Supervisor for S3PR
    Abdul-Hussin, Mowafak
    [J]. PROCEEDINGS SIXTH INTERNATIONAL CONFERENCE ON INTELLIGENT SYSTEMS, MODELLING AND SIMULATION, 2015, : 46 - 52
  • [5] A deadlock prevention policy using elementary siphons
    Li, ZW
    Ma, X
    [J]. 2005 INTERNATIONAL CONFERENCE ON CONTROL AND AUTOMATION (ICCA), VOLS 1 AND 2, 2005, : 1193 - 1198
  • [6] An effective FMS deadlock prevention policy based on elementary siphons
    Li, ZW
    Zhou, MC
    [J]. 2004 IEEE INTERNATIONAL CONFERENCE ON ROBOTICS AND AUTOMATION, VOLS 1- 5, PROCEEDINGS, 2004, : 3143 - 3148
  • [7] A Siphon-Based Deadlock Prevention Strategy for S3PR
    Guo, Xin
    Wang, Shouguang
    You, Dan
    Li, Zhifu
    Jiang, Xiaoning
    [J]. IEEE ACCESS, 2019, 7 : 86863 - 86873
  • [8] Deadlock Prevention Policy based on Elementary Siphons for Flexible Manufacturing systems
    Yan, Mingming
    Hu, Hesuan
    Li, Zhiwu
    [J]. 2008 IEEE/ASME INTERNATIONAL CONFERENCE ON ADVANCED INTELLIGENT MECHATRONICS, VOLS 1-3, 2008, : 229 - 234
  • [9] Structures for Weakly Dependent Siphons of S3PR
    Chao, Daniel Yuh
    Chen, Jiun-Ting
    [J]. ADVANCED DESIGNS AND RESEARCHES FOR MANUFACTURING, PTS 1-3, 2013, 605-607 : 1841 - 1844
  • [10] An iterative Deadlock Prevention Policy Based on siphons
    Zhuang, Qiaoli
    Dai, Wenzhan
    Wang, Shouguang
    You, Dan
    Du, Jingjing
    [J]. PROCEEDINGS OF THE 2019 IEEE 16TH INTERNATIONAL CONFERENCE ON NETWORKING, SENSING AND CONTROL (ICNSC 2019), 2019, : 242 - 246